zoukankan      html  css  js  c++  java
  • 结对开发Ⅲ——电梯调度需求分析

    一、引言

       1.1实验目的

        为更好利用电梯资源,方便师生上下楼梯,不在堵塞,故对电梯调度进行优化。

        1.2 电梯调度背景

       新建基础教学楼共有18层。共5部电现状:总共有18层, 电梯。每个电梯限15人,1150kg。大厅北侧共四部电梯。两部电梯停1层和8~18的双层,另外两部停1层和8~18层的单层。还有一部是教师专用电梯。其中学生上课教室在1到5层,按学校规定来说,学生上课没有电梯可用。该教学楼,师生较多,楼层较多。如何更好的利用电梯,更好的便于师生,成为一种必要的需求。

    二、任务概述

      2.1 目标

        最大限度地实现电梯调度优化,便于师生乘坐电梯。

      2.2 特点

        学生上课1至5楼不乘坐电梯,老师乘坐老师专属电梯。8--18层电梯乘客随机。

      2.3假定和约束

         5部电梯,两个8---18停单层,两个8--18停双层,一个老师专属电梯。

    三、需求规定

    3.1功能说明

       1. 电梯内乘客上下层提示

       2.电梯内重量提示

       3.每层楼层内乘客需上下层的提示

    3.2对功能的规定

       电梯提示到达哪层,电梯出错会自动报警

    3.3对性能规定

       1.实现电梯稳定性,不能出现错误。

       2.实现电梯算法优化,尽可能考虑到每一层的用户,实现每层用户乘电梯时间最短。

       3.算法应该成模块,便于以后修改和替换。

    3.4输入输出

       电梯内用户对去哪层的输入电梯外用户对上下的输入。

       出错时对监控室的报错提示

    四、调研方法

      为了优化电梯调度,必须熟悉电梯的调度,我们进行以下方法进行测试电梯

    五、小组成员(郭健豪、杨广鑫)

  • 相关阅读:
    【javascript基础】JS计算字符串所占字节数
    mysql设置有外键的主键自增及其他
    spring AOP简单实现代码存放
    Dockerfile指令及docker的常用命令
    ubuntu 16.04 jenkins pipline的实现 最终docker启动服务
    ubuntu16.04 docker安装
    ubuntu16.04 nginx安装
    ubuntu14.04 spring cloud config server + gradle搭建
    ubuntu14.04 python2.7安装MySQLdb
    flask初次搭建rest服务笔记
  • 原文地址:https://www.cnblogs.com/KevinBin/p/4370254.html
Copyright © 2011-2022 走看看